How much do internship electrical engineer nvidia j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 1, 2026, the average hourly pay for internship electrical engineer nvidia in Atlanta, GA is $20.83,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.55 and $23.12 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an internship electrical engineer do at Nvidia?

An Internship Electrical Engineer at Nvidia assists in designing, testing, and troubleshooting hardware components for advanced computing products such as GPUs and AI systems. Interns may work with cross-functional teams to develop circuit boards, analyze electrical performance, and support prototype builds. They gain hands-on experience with industry-leading technology while learning about Nvidia’s design and manufacturing processes. The role involves using engineering tools, running simulations, and documenting findings to contribute to the development of innovative products.

What kinds of projects do electrical engineering interns typically work on at Nvidia, and how do these projects contribute to the company's goals?

As an Electrical Engineering intern at Nvidia, you can expect to work on hands-on projects that support the development and testing of cutting-edge hardware components, such as GPUs and AI accelerators. Interns often assist in circuit design, schematic review, board bring-up, and validation, collaborating closely with experienced engineers. These projects are integral to Nvidia's mission of advancing high-performance computing and AI technologies, and your contributions can have a direct impact on the performance and reliability of Nvidia’s products. The fast-paced, team-oriented environment encourages learning and skill development while providing valuable industry exper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an internship electrical engineer at Nvidia,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Internship Electrical Engineer at Nvidia, you need a solid background in electrical engineering principles, circuit design, and familiarity with hardware development, typically supported by enrollment in or recent graduation from an accredited engineering program. Experience with tools such as SPICE simulation, PCB design software (e.g., Altium Designer), and programming languages like Python or C/C++ is highly beneficial. Strong problem-solving abilities, collaboration, and effective communication help interns contribute to team projects and adapt to Nvidia's fast-paced environment. These skills and qualities are crucial for delivering innovative hardware solutions and supporting Nvidia’s cutting-edge technology development.

Job description


Early Career Electrical Engineer – Space Systems

On-site – Atlanta, GA


About West Coast Solutions


West Coast Solutions develops advanced electronic systems for aerospace, power, and cryogenic applications. As a growing team of experienced aerospace professionals, we combine technical excellence with the agility and ownership opportunities that come from working in a small, high-impact organization. We are expanding our presence in Atlanta with a new satellite office in Midtown, built to grow alongside Georgia Tech talent and our collaboration with the Georgia Tech Space Research Institute (GT SRI).


We are seeking an Electrical Engineer to support the design, analysis, testing, and development of power systems and mechanism controllers for space and lunar applications. Working alongside experienced engineers, you will contribute to hardware development efforts ranging from concept design and simulation through laboratory testing and product validation. This is an immediate hiring need and a great fit for engineers looking to accelerate their technical growth while making meaningful contributions working on real flight programs in close collaboration with Jet Propulsion Laboratory, aerospace primes, GT SRI, and others.


What You'll Do


  • Support the design and development of power systems and mechanism controllers for space and lunar applications
  • Support the design and development of analog, digital, mixed-signal, and power electronic systems
  • Perform circuit analysis, simulation, and component selection activities
  • Assist with schematic development and hardware integration efforts
  • Support prototype builds and product validation efforts
  • Participate in design reviews and technical discussions
  • Create and maintain engineering documentation and test reports
  • Collaborate with multidisciplinary engineering teams throughout product development


Required Qualifications


  • Bachelor's, Master's, or PhD in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, Physics, or a related technical discipline
  • Strong understanding of electrical engineering fundamentals
  • Exposure to circuit analysis, simulation, or electronic hardware development
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ills
  • Willingness to learn, adapt, and take on new technical challenges


Preferred Qualifications


  • Some professional engineering experience preferred; Master's or PhD graduates, or Bachelor's graduates with strong co-op/internship experience, are encouraged to apply
  • Experience with aerospace, defense, space, or other high-reliability electronic systems
  • Experience with SPICE or similar circuit simulation tools
  • Experience with power electronics, embedded systems, or digital control systems
  • Experience with FPGA or microcontroller-based hardware
  • Experience supporting hardware development through test and validation activities
  • Hands-on experience troubleshooting electronic hardware
  • Interest or coursework in spacecraft, lunar, or planetary systems


Compensation & Benefits


Salary Range: $90,000 - $115,000 dependent on experience, qualifications, and demonstrated capability.


  • Performance Bonus: Eligible employees participate in an annual bonus program based on individual contribution and company performance.
  • Healthcare Coverage: Receive a monthly healthcare stipend and choice of multiple company healthcare plans. HSA-compatible plans are available.
  • Retirement Planning: Simple IRA with 3% company matching and immediate vesting.
  • Paid Time Off: 10 days PTO, 10 paid holidays, and sick leave.
  • Equity Opportunity: After 12 months of employment, select employees may be considered for participation in the company's incentive stock option program based on performance and contribution.
  • Professional Growth: Work alongside experienced aerospace professionals on challenging technical programs with opportunities for career advancement, with direct exposure to space and lunar hardware programs.


West Coast Solutions is an Equal Opportunity Employer.


Due to the sensitive nature of our work and export control requirements, applicants must be US citizens.
